The majority of the cleaning service operators we spoke to used personal savings to start their organizations, then reinvested their early revenues to fund development - commercial cleaning. If you require to buy equipment, you should be able to find financing, particularly if you can show that you have actually put some of your own money into the organization.

Some recommendations: Do an extensive stock of your possessions. People usually have more assets than they right away realize. This could include cost savings accounts, equity in realty, retirement accounts, vehicles, leisure devices, collections and other financial investments. You may choose to offer properties for money or utilize them as security for a loan.

Lots of an effective organization has actually been started with credit cards. The next rational action after collecting your own resources is to approach good friends and relatives who think in you and wish to assist you succeed. Be cautious with these plans; no matter how close you are, present yourself expertly, put everything in writing, and make sure the people you approach can pay for to take the threat of investing in your organization.

Using the "strength in numbers" principle, look around for someone who might wish to partner with you in your venture. You may pick somebody who has funds and wishes to work side-by-side with you in the service. Or you might find somebody who has cash to invest but no interest in doing the real work.

Benefit from the abundance of regional, state and federal programs developed to support small businesses. Make your first stop the U.S. Small company Administration; then investigate numerous other programs. Ladies, minorities and veterans ought to have a look at niche financing possibilities created to assist these groups enter service. After all, your clients will likely never ever concerned your center since all your work is done on their properties. But that's not the only issue influencing your decision to operate from a homebased office or a commercial location. Lots of municipalities have ordinances that restrict the nature and volume of commercial activities that can occur in houses.

Others might permit such business however place limitations regarding problems such as signs, traffic, workers, commercially marked automobiles and noise. Before you make an application for your company license, learn what regulations govern homebased businesses; you might need to adjust your plan to be in compliance. Many industry veterans think that in order to attain genuine company development, you need to leave the house and into a business facility.

Your workplace location should be big enough to have a small reception area, work space on your own and your administrative personnel, and a storage location for equipment and products. You might also want to have area for a laundry and perhaps even a little work location where you can manage minor devices repairs.

Despite the type of cleaning company you have, bear in mind that opportunities are slim that your consumers will ever come to your workplace. So try to find a facility that fulfills your functional needs and remains in a fairly safe location, but don't spend for a distinguished address-- it's simply not worth it.

In truth, your cars are basically your business on wheels. They require to be carefully chosen and properly maintained to adequately serve and represent you. For a housemaid service, an economy vehicle or station wagon must be enough. You require adequate space to shop equipment and supplies, and to carry your cleansing groups, however you generally will not be transporting around pieces of equipment big enough to require a van or little truck.

If you offer the cars, paint your company's name, logo design and telephone number on them. This advertises your service all over town. If your employees use their own vehicles-- which is particularly common with housemaid services-- ask for proof that they have enough insurance to cover them in case of an accident.

The type of automobiles you'll require for a janitorial service depends on the size and type of equipment you utilize in addition to the size and number of your crews. An economy automobile or station wagon might work if you're doing reasonably light cleansing in smaller offices, but for a lot of janitorial companies, you're most likely to need a truck or van.

A good utilized truck will cost about $10,000, while a brand-new one will run from $18,000 up. Openly ask what you can do to guarantee prompt payment; that may consist of validating the right billing address and learning what paperwork might be needed to assist the client determine the credibility of the invoice. Remember that lots of big companies pay certain types of invoices on certain days of the month; discover if your consumers do that, and schedule your billings to show up in time for the next payment cycle.

Terms consist of the date the invoice is due, any discount rate for early payment and added fees for late payment. It's likewise a good concept to particularly specify the date the invoice ends up being unpaid to avoid any possible misconception. If you're going to charge a penalty for late payment, be sure your invoice mentions that it's a late payment or rebilling fee, not a financing charge.

Mention any approaching specials, new services or other information that may encourage your consumers to utilize more of your services. Add a flier or sales brochure to the envelope-- despite the fact that the billing is going to an existing customer, you never understand where your sales brochures will wind up.
